Trivino earned the save against the Angels on Friday, allowing one hit in one scoreless inning.

Oakland's closer allowed the tying run to reach base when Justin Upton led off the ninth with a double to left field, but Trivino bounced back to retire the next three batters on groundouts. The save was Trivino's fourth in July, and he has posted a 1.59 ERA, 1.15 WHIP and 10:7 K:BB across 11.1 innings this month.
